I've come across a minor behavioural difference with the new PB 2017 IDE Build 1666. When I search across the PBLs in my workspace, then edit from the search result set. It opens the object's script as expected. If do a CTRL-H to replace the searched text, it will not make the change unless I firstly set the cursor focus into the script area before doing the replace. The replace would work in previous PB versions without having to set the focus first.

The same applies to CTRL-F find. Has anyone else come across this?
